Replacing windows is a custom job, so your final bill depends on a few specific variables. The size and style of the window frames—like double-hung versus large picture windows—play a big role. Choosing energy-efficient glass coatings or adding decorative grids can also shift the total. We also look at the condition of your existing frames and whether the installation requires structural repairs to the surrounding wall. Your ex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.
When calculating what you will spend, consider that the type of window operation, such as double-hung or casement, changes the labor time required for a proper install. Upgrading to energy-efficient glass or decorative grids will also influence the final bill. Correct window installation in Vancouver homes involves meticulous sealing and flashing to prevent leaks and drafts, essential for the region's weather. Pros ensure windows are plumb, level, and securely fastened to the house structure. They focus on creating a watertight barrier between the window and the building. This professional approach guarantees optimal performance and long-term energy efficiency.

While DIY window installation might seem cheaper in Vancouver, incorrect installation can lead to costly repairs from leaks and drafts, especially with the local climate. Professional installers have the expertise and tools for a perfect fit and seal, ensuring long-term energy efficiency. This often proves more cost-effective in the long run by preventing future problems and maximizing your home's comfort. Trusting the pros offers peace of mind.
